The Triangulum Galaxy, also known as M33, is a spiral galaxy in the Local Group. It is visible as a faint, fuzzy patch of light in the constellation Triangulum. The galaxy is about 3 million light-years away from Earth and is the third-largest member of the Local Group, after the Milky Way and the Andromeda Galaxy.
